Output e55bc7efeb6cf38b1cfc6180e691a568f95b16130c6689cc89d5e4fea7eac7d8:1

value
12456773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a33a21bf9fba5acf70a3fea3e824c621325438d OP_EQUAL
address
3HCxehHDPeaKWpGwCXKjnLFX6ToLg16ScS
transaction
e55bc7efeb6cf38b1cfc6180e691a568f95b16130c6689cc89d5e4fea7eac7d8
spent
true